Adam Milstead is an American mixed martial arts fighter currently competing in the Light Heavyweight division of the Ultimate Fighting Championship. A professional competitor since 2009, he has also competed for King of the Cage.

Background

Born and raised in Calvert, Maryland, Milstead began wrestling in the second grade, and was a standout in football and wrestling at Calvert High School, graduating in 2006. Milstead later continued his football career at the collegiate level for half a semester before dropping out.[1]

Mixed martial arts career

Early career

Milstead held an amateur record of 10-2 before making his professional MMA debut in May 2011. After losing his first match, he amassed a record of 7-1 before signing with the UFC.

Ultimate Fighting Championship

Milstead made his UFC debut in May 2016 as he faced Chris de la Rocha at UFC Fight Night: Almeida vs. Garbrandt. He won the fight by TKO in the second round.[2]

For his second fight with the promotion, Milstead faced Curtis Blaydes at UFC Fight Night: Bermudez vs. Korean Zombie on February 4, 2017. He originally lost the fight via TKO in the second round; however, the win was later overturned to a No Contest when Blaydes tested positive for marijuana.[3]

For his next fight, Milstead moved down to the Light Heavyweight division. He faced Jordan Johnson on March 3, 2018 at UFC 222.[4] He lost the fight by split decision.[5]
